Recovery Time After Botox Injections

Acknowledging the recovery period after receiving Botox is crucial for both effectiveness and safety. Engaging in physical activity too soon can disrupt the treatment’s intended effects and even lead to undesirable outcomes. The following points highlight the significance of allowing your body to recover adequately before resuming workouts:

  • After receiving Botox, it is generally recommended to wait at least 24 hours before engaging in light physical activities. This waiting period allows the Botox to settle in the desired areas effectively.
  • Heavier exercises, particularly those that induce sweating or significant muscle movement, should typically be avoided for at least 48 to 72 hours. This helps minimize the risk of the Botox migrating to unintended areas.
  • Listening to your body and monitoring how you feel post-injection is essential; if you experience any unusual sensations or discomfort, it may be wise to extend your rest period.
  • Consulting with your healthcare professional post-treatment can provide personalized guidelines on when to safely resume your regular exercise routine.

Types of Workouts and Their Impact on Recovery Time

Understanding the nature of various workouts is essential in determining their impact on recovery post-Botox. Here’s a glimpse into different types of workouts and how they may influence the healing process:

  • Low-Impact Activities: Gentle walks, yoga, or stretching can often be resumed within 24 hours. These activities promote blood flow without straining the treated areas.
  • Moderate Workouts: Activities such as light jogging or resistance training can typically be reintroduced after 48 hours, allowing some movement while being mindful of the injection sites.
  • High-Impact Exercises: High-intensity workouts, heavy lifting, or competitive sports should generally be avoided for at least 72 hours post-treatment to allow complete absorption and settling of the Botox.

Potential Complications from Premature Workouts

It’s vital to recognize the specific complications that might arise when one decides to return to their fitness routine too soon. The following points highlight critical issues associated with exercising shortly after Botox:

  • Increased Swelling and Bruising: Physical exertion elevates blood pressure and can exacerbate bruising and swelling, extending recovery time.
  • Migration of Botox: Excessive movement can lead to the migration of Botox to unintended muscles, causing asymmetrical results that may require additional treatments to correct.
  • Headaches: Engaging in strenuous activities can trigger tension headaches, particularly if the injection sites are still sensitive.
  • Prolonged Downtime: The body’s healing process may be impeded, prolonging the downtime that many seek to minimize.

Dos and Don’ts Following Botox Treatment

To cultivate a nurturing environment for your skin after Botox, consider the following practices:

Dos:

  • Rest your face for the first few hours post-treatment.
  • Stay upright for the first four hours to allow the Botox to settle properly.
  • Engage in gentle facial exercises, as advised by your practitioner.
  • Hydrate adequately to support skin health.
  • Apply a gentle moisturizer to keep the skin nourished.

Don’ts:

  • Avoid strenuous exercise for 24 hours.
  • Do not touch or massage the treated area for at least 24 hours.
  • Refrain from consuming alcohol for at least 24 hours to minimize swelling.
  • Steer clear of extreme temperatures, such as saunas or hot tubs, for the first 48 hours.
  • Avoid lying down flat for the first four hours after treatment.

Common Queries

Can I do light workouts right after Botox?

No, it’s best to wait at least 24 hours before engaging in any form of physical activity.

What happens if I exercise too soon after Botox?

Exercising too soon can lead to complications, including uneven results and bruising.

Is there a specific type of exercise I should avoid?

Avoid high-intensity workouts and activities that cause heavy sweating for at least 48 hours.

How can I tell if I’m ready to workout again?

If you’re feeling good and there’s no swelling or bruising, consult with your healthcare provider about resuming your routine.

Should I wait longer if I had a larger Botox treatment?

Yes, larger treatments may require a longer waiting period; always consult your doctor for personalized advice.
